DCCF060M65G2 MOSFET Equivalente. Reemplazo. Hoja de especificaciones. Principales características
Número de Parte: DCCF060M65G2
Tipo de FET: MOSFET
Polaridad de transistor: N
ESPECIFICACIONES MÁXIMAS
Pdⓘ - Máxima disipación de potencia: 166 W
|Vds|ⓘ - Voltaje máximo drenador-fuente: 650 V
|Vgs|ⓘ - Voltaje máximo fuente-puerta: 22 V
|Id|ⓘ - Corriente continua de drenaje: 41 A
Tjⓘ - Temperatura máxima de unión: 175 °C
CARACTERÍSTICAS ELÉCTRICAS
trⓘ - Tiempo de subida: 9 nS
Cossⓘ - Capacitancia de salida: 82 pF
RDSonⓘ - Resistencia estado encendido drenaje a fuente: 0.079 Ohm
Encapsulados: TO247-4

DCC060M65G2/DCCF060M65G2 41A 650V N-channel SiC Power MOSFET 1 Description This product family offers state of the art performance. It is designed for high frequency applications where high efficiency and high reliability are required. 2 Features Higher System Efficiency Reduced Cooling Requirements Increased Power Density Increased System Switching Frequency
